I have had the best luck with B1 stepping with the 2.4.4 kernels from
kernel.org.
Later kernels have dropped support for older B steping.

My C0 Big Sur is running 2.4.9 with no problems.

Hi all,

have any of you had any luck trying to boot RedHat 7.1 with stock kernel on
B1-stepping Dual cpu
BigSur with BIOS 99. I know that hardware is sort of outdated.
When installing Wolverine on the same BigSurs, I had to recompile the stock
kernel making the
SCSI-driver (qla-1280) static part of the kernel to be able to boot.
However, recompiling the RH 7.1 kernel with SCSI-driver as static part of
the kernel, did not solve
my boot problems.

Suggestions is highly appreciated!
